A hot plate is a laboratory device used to heat and maintain the temperature of a sample. Hot plates are designed with a flat surface equipped with heating elements. Laboratory hot plates are pivotal tools in scientific research, offering precise heat sources for a variety of experimental needs. In mining industries, hot plates are used to heat hazardous chemicals by using a protective coating. Hot plates are frequently used in the laboratory to perform chemical reactions, to heat samples, and for numerous other activities.
